CVE-2026-34739

CVE-2026-34739 is a medium-severity vulnerability in Wwbn Avideo with a CVSS 3.x base score of 6.1. It is not currently listed as actively exploited by CISA, and its EPSS exploit-prediction score is low. The underlying weakness is classified as CWE-79.

Key facts

Description

WWBN AVideo is an open source video platform. In versions 26.0 and prior, the User_Location plugin's testIP.php page reflects the ip request parameter directly into an HTML input element without applying htmlspecialchars() or any other output encoding. This allows an attacker to inject arbitrary HTML and JavaScript via a crafted URL. Although the page is restricted to admin users, AVideo's SameSite=None cookie configuration allows cross-origin exploitation, meaning an attacker can lure an admin to a malicious link that executes JavaScript in their authenticated session. At time of publication, there are no publicly available patches.

How severe is CVE-2026-34739?
CVE-2026-34739 has a CVSS 3.x base score of 6.1, rated medium severity. It is exploitable over network with low attack complexity, requires no privileges and user interaction. Impact on confidentiality is low, integrity low, and availability none.
Is CVE-2026-34739 being actively exploited?
It is not currently listed in CISA's KEV catalog. Its EPSS exploit-prediction score is 0% (12th percentile), an estimate of the probability of exploitation in the next 30 days.
